Price (delayed)

$9.38

Market cap

$326.9M

P/E Ratio

6.56

Dividend/share

N/A

EPS

$1.43

Enterprise value

-$308.99M

What are the main financial stats of GLRE

Market
Valuations
Earnings

Shares outstanding

34.85M

Price to earnings (P/E)

6.56

Price to book (P/B)

0.69

Price to sales (P/S)

0.58

EV/EBIT

-5.1

EV/EBITDA

-5.09

EV/Sales

-0.55

Revenue

$558.57M

EBIT

$60.63M

EBITDA

$60.65M

Free cash flow

-$78.3M

Per share
Balance sheet
Liquidity

Free cash flow per share

-$2.27

Book value per share

$13.68

Revenue per share

$16.18

TBVPS

$41.19

Total assets

$1.42B

Total liabilities

$949.99M

Debt

$95.34M

Equity

$472.12M

Working capital

N/A

Debt to equity

0.2

Current ratio

N/A

Quick ratio

N/A

Net debt/EBITDA

-10.48

Margins
Efficiency
Dividend

EBITDA margin

10.9%

Gross margin

35.6%

Net margin

9.1%

Operating margin

10.9%

Return on assets

3.8%

Return on equity

11.3%

Return on invested capital

8.7%

Return on capital employed

N/A

Return on sales

10.9%

How has the Greenlight Capital Re stock price performed over time

Intraday

-0.95%

1 week

0.86%

1 month

-2.09%

1 year

36.73%

YTD

28.32%

QTD

7.82%

How have Greenlight Capital Re's revenue and profit performed over time

Revenue

$558.57M

Gross profit

$198.71M

Operating income

$60.63M

Net income

$50.64M

Gross margin

35.6%

Net margin

9.1%

GLRE's net margin has surged by 183% year-on-year

Greenlight Capital Re's gross profit has soared by 74% YoY and by 36% from the previous quarter

The gross margin has grown by 42% YoY and by 18% from the previous quarter

The revenue has grown by 23% YoY and by 15% from the previous quarter

What is Greenlight Capital Re's growth rate over time

What is Greenlight Capital Re stock price valuation

GLRE's P/B is 15% above its last 4 quarters average of 0.6 but 14% below its 5-year quarterly average of 0.8

The equity has grown by 8% year-on-year

The P/S is 52% less than the 5-year quarterly average of 1.2 and 3.3% less than the last 4 quarters average of 0.6

The revenue has grown by 23% YoY and by 15% from the previous quarter

How efficient is Greenlight Capital Re business performance

What is GLRE's dividend

There are no recent dividends present for GLRE.

How did Greenlight Capital Re financials performed over time

The total assets is 50% greater than the total liabilities

Greenlight Capital Re's total liabilities has increased by 12% YoY and by 6% from the previous quarter

The total assets rose by 10% year-on-year and by 4.7% since the previous quarter

GLRE's debt is 80% smaller than its equity

The equity has grown by 8% year-on-year

Greenlight Capital Re's debt to equity has decreased by 4.8% QoQ and by 4.8% YoY

All financial data is based on trailing twelve months (TTM) periods - updated quarterly, unless otherwise specified.